<dcvalue element="description" qualifier="abstract">Here&#x20;we&#x20;introduce&#x20;novel&#x20;methods&#x20;of&#x20;forming&#x20;silver&#x20;(Ag)&#x20;and&#x20;palladium&#x20;(Pd)&#x20;fibers.&#x20;The&#x20;Ag&#x20;and&#x20;Pd&#x20;fibers&#x20;are&#x20;fabricated&#x20;by&#x20;the&#x20;combination&#x20;of&#x20;electrospinning,&#x20;electroplating,&#x20;and&#x20;ion-exchange&#x20;techniques.&#x20;Their&#x20;properties&#x20;are&#x20;characterized&#x20;by&#x20;scanning&#x20;electron&#x20;microscope&#x20;with&#x20;energy&#x20;dispersive&#x20;X-ray&#x20;spectroscopy,&#x20;sheet&#x20;resistance&#x20;meter,&#x20;UV-Vis&#x20;spectrophotometer,&#x20;and&#x20;X-ray&#x20;photoelectron&#x20;spectroscope.&#x20;These&#x20;non-woven&#x20;metal&#x20;fibers&#x20;are&#x20;free-standing&#x20;and&#x20;film-shaped&#x20;with&#x20;high&#x20;electrical&#x20;conductivity,&#x20;as&#x20;well&#x20;as&#x20;flexibility.&#x20;Such&#x20;properties&#x20;are&#x20;attractive&#x20;for&#x20;future&#x20;applications&#x20;of&#x20;these&#x20;materials&#x20;in&#x20;various&#x20;electrochemical&#x20;processes.&#x20;(C)&#x20;2017&#x20;Elsevier&#x20;B.V.&#x20;All&#x20;rights&#x20;reserved.</dcvalue>
